diff options
author | Pepe Iborra <mnislaih@gmail.com> | 2007-05-09 10:18:54 +0000 |
---|---|---|
committer | Pepe Iborra <mnislaih@gmail.com> | 2007-05-09 10:18:54 +0000 |
commit | ba3819264292ce81f02495f67887a0568d373d1e (patch) | |
tree | c4bf4514ebeacd0d1aa8b5f61630ec9d9848ed40 /compiler/ghci/Debugger.hs | |
parent | 4a6a64b9f9437e40706368bf288d62f1aa5060a5 (diff) | |
download | haskell-ba3819264292ce81f02495f67887a0568d373d1e.tar.gz |
Fixed a badly defined pattern match
Diffstat (limited to 'compiler/ghci/Debugger.hs')
-rw-r--r-- | compiler/ghci/Debugger.hs |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/compiler/ghci/Debugger.hs b/compiler/ghci/Debugger.hs index 44c37fb329..33fcf61d73 100644 --- a/compiler/ghci/Debugger.hs +++ b/compiler/ghci/Debugger.hs @@ -99,7 +99,7 @@ pprintClosureCommand session bindThings force str = do ids' = map (\id -> id `setIdType` substTy subst (idType id)) ids subst_dom= varEnvKeys$ getTvSubstEnv subst subst_ran= varEnvElts$ getTvSubstEnv subst - new_tvs = [ tv | t <- subst_ran, let Just tv = getTyVar_maybe t] + new_tvs = [ tv | Just tv <- map getTyVar_maybe subst_ran] ic_tyvars'= (`delVarSetListByKey` subst_dom) . (`extendVarSetList` new_tvs) $ ic_tyvars ictxt |